Diagnosing, explaining and scaling machine learning is hard. Ian Ozsvald will talk about a set of libraries that have helped him to understand when and how a model is failing, helped him communicate why it is working to non-technical users, automated the search for better models and helped him to scale his modeling.
Ian will discuss YellowBrick, LIME, ELI5, TPOT and Dask. These libraries will make it more likely that you deliver trustworthy and reliable systems that will actually make it past R&D and into Production. The talk will be rooted in his experience delivering client projects and participating in Kaggle competitions.
